The GE IC695CMM002 serves as a dedicated serial communication module for PACSystems RX3i programmable logic controllers. This module enables reliable data exchange between the PLC and various industrial devices using multiple protocols. It consequently provides enhanced connectivity flexibility for diverse automation applications.

Technical Specifications
| Parameter | Specification |
|---|---|
| Dimensions | 13 cm (H) x 5 cm (W) x 12 cm (D) |
| Weight | 0.2 kg approximately |
| Module Type | Serial communication module |
| Ports | 2 isolated RS-232/RS-485 serial ports |
| Connector Type | 15-pin D-subminiature (female) per port |
| Baud Rate | Up to 115.2 kbps |
| Supported Protocols | SNP, Modbus RTU Master/Slave, Serial I/O, CCM |
| Power Requirements | 360 mA @ 3.3 VDC, 190 mA @ 5 VDC |
| Total Power | 2.1 watts maximum |
| Isolation | 1500 V optical between ports and backplane |
| Component Count | 180+ ICs, optocouplers, capacitors, resistors |
| Energy Storage | 100 µF filtering capacitors on power rails |
| Configuration Software | Proficy Machine Edition |
| Status Indicators | Module OK, communication status, TX/RX per port |
| Operating Temperature | 0°C to +60°C |
| Storage Temperature | -40°C to +85°C |
| Humidity Range | 5% to 95% non-condensing |
| Backplane Current Draw | 360 mA at 3.3 V, 190 mA at 5 V |
Serial Port Configuration
The IC695CMM002 features two independently configurable serial ports for maximum application flexibility. Each port supports either RS-232 or RS-485 electrical interfaces through software selection. You can connect devices like drives, HMIs, scales, and barcode scanners directly to these ports. The 15-pin D-sub connectors provide reliable connections with secure locking screws.
Protocol Support
This module supports multiple industrial protocols to interface with a wide range of devices. SNP protocol enables communication with other GE Series 90 PLCs for data exchange. Modbus RTU Master and Slave modes allow connectivity with thousands of Modbus-compatible devices. Serial I/O mode provides custom protocol development for specialized equipment. CCM protocol supports legacy GE communication requirements.
Isolation and Noise Immunity
Each serial port includes 1500 volts of optical isolation from the backplane and other circuits. This isolation prevents ground loops that commonly cause communication errors in industrial settings. It also protects the RX3i backplane from voltage transients on field wiring. Consequently, the IC695CMM002 maintains reliable communication even in electrically noisy environments.
Power Distribution and Filtering
The module draws 360 milliamps from the 3.3 VDC backplane supply and 190 milliamps from 5 VDC. Internal filtering capacitors smooth any voltage ripple that could affect communication stability. Dedicated power regulators ensure clean supply voltages to the serial transceivers. This careful power design contributes to error-free data transmission at maximum baud rates.
LED Status Indicators
Front-panel LEDs provide immediate visual feedback on module and communication status. A green OK LED illuminates when the module passes its power-up diagnostics and operates normally. Each serial port has dedicated TX and RX LEDs that flash during data transmission. These indicators greatly simplify troubleshooting during system commissioning.
Configuration and Programming
Engineers configure the IC695CMM002 using Proficy Machine Edition software within the RX3i project. You can set port parameters like baud rate, parity, stop bits, and protocol through simple drop-down menus. The software also allows custom serial I/O message construction for non-standard protocols. All configuration stores in non-volatile memory within the module.
Application Examples
This communication module excels in applications requiring connection to multiple serial devices. A typical installation might connect variable frequency drives via Modbus RTU on port one. Port two could simultaneously communicate with an operator interface using SNP protocol. The module handles both conversations independently without burdening the main CPU.
